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 041195 1370 06 6159774
9648252514 9085777988
9648252514 9085777988
576 5184513 573763 920 79495155
All about undefined
Interested in learning more?
9648252514 9085777988
576 5184513 573763 920 79495155
See more
85389 92725 31115472256
30 076 4367
See more
40669243 6708
352606 8163 1269 08863526
See more